Logo ms.androidermagazine.com
Logo ms.androidermagazine.com

Sdks, pemandu dan akar - oh, saya!

Isi kandungan:

Anonim

Hei, semua. Memperkenalkan ciri baharu kepada pembaca AndroidCentral kami. Ia ruang kecil di mana kita boleh membincangkan dan menampilkan minggu terbaik dalam pemodelan dan komuniti penggodam Android, dari segi walaupun mereka yang baru untuk Android dapat memahami.

Ini tidak akan menjadi peranti atau pembawa khusus, jadi fikirkan ia sebagai pameran segala-galanya yang ditawarkan oleh Android kerana sifatnya yang terbuka. Veteran kami yang berpengalaman mungkin menemui beberapa perkara ini yang berlebihan, tetapi kami akan cuba untuk menjaga perkara di peringkat yang semua dapat difahami supaya kami tinggal di halaman yang sama. Versi minggu ini akan agak lama supaya kita boleh memperkenalkan beberapa perkara, jadi beri saya.

Ingatlah, saya tidak boleh berada di mana-mana seketika (sehingga saya menyempurnakan mesin kloning saya!) Jadi mungkin saya akan terlepas sesuatu yang tidak anda lakukan. Cara terbaik untuk memastikan bahawa perkara itu berlaku adalah menghantar saya petua dan pautan tentang semua cara yang kerap kami menyesuaikan telefon kami. Sama seperti komuniti penyesuaian mari kita buat usaha bersama!

Sekarang pada barang-barang.

Setiap minggu kami akan menampilkan beberapa helah yang boleh anda lakukan dengan hanya arahan arahan dan kabel data. Walaupun terdapat fail muat turun dan zip dan ROM dan semua jenis kesejukan lain yang boleh anda lakukan dengan telefon anda, seringkali helah yang paling mudah dapat membuat kesan yang paling.

SDK Android

Minggu ini kita akan bermula pada mulanya. Memasang Android SDK - itu pendek untuk Kit Pembangunan Perisian - yang membolehkan pemaju melakukan perkara mereka. Dan kini anda boleh juga.

Langkah 1: Buat kerja dan muat turun

Pertama, mari menyediakan ruang kerja pada PC anda. Saran saya adalah untuk membuat folder di peringkat atas cakera keras anda supaya mudah untuk mendapatkan dari baris arahan. C: \ Android_stuff lebih mudah diingat daripada C: \ users \ gbhil \ documents \ tools \ devices \ Android \ stuff. Saya menggunakan ruang kerja saya untuk sandaran, wallpaper, ROM, dan alatan serta SDK. Hanya buat folder berasingan di dalam ruang kerja anda untuk setiap. Klik imej di bawah untuk membesarkannya dan lihat bagaimana saya telah menetapkan folder Android_stuff saya.

Kini sudah tiba masanya untuk memuat turun SDK. Kepala ke https://developer.android.com/studio. Anda akan melihat muat turun untuk Windows, Mac OS X, dan Linux. Pilih kategori yang sesuai dan muat turun fail ke desktop anda. Jangan dimatikan oleh perjanjian lesen. Mempunyai bacaan dan anda akan melihat ia agak standard.

Unzip muat turun dengan alat pengarkib kegemaran anda dan seret folder yang diekstrak ke Workspace anda. Jangan buka folder, seret semua perkara. Itu sahaja. Android SDK kini dipasang.

Langkah 2: Pasang pemacu USB - kejahatan yang diperlukan

Pemasangan pemandu USB hampir sama dengan mudah, walaupun ia mengambil beberapa langkah, dan anda perlu melakukannya jika anda menjalankan Windows. Buka folder SDK yang baru sahaja anda alihkan, dan klik dua kali "SDK Setup.exe" dalam direktori SDK. Anda akan melihat tetingkap seperti yang di bawah.

Pastikan "Pakej yang Tersedia" di anak tetingkap kiri dipilih.

Klik segitiga di sebelah dunia di barisan atas untuk mengembangkan senarai.

Apa yang saya bingkai dengan warna merah dalam contoh gambar kita perlu diperiksa. Itu akan memuat turun pemacu USB. Kecuali anda mempunyai minat dalam pembangunan perisian atau menjalankan emulator peranti Android, anda boleh meninggalkan segala yang tidak dicentang. Jika anda memutuskan untuk memasang bahagian-bahagian lain, bersiap sedia untuk memuat turun 1 Gigabyte.

Klik pemasangan yang dipilih. Pemandu akan memuat turun ke dalam SDK.

Kini pada peranti anda, tekan butang menu. Pilih Tetapan (rajah 1), kemudian pilih Aplikasi (rajah 2). Sekarang klik Pembangunan (rajah 3), dan pastikan debugging USB disemak (rajah 4). Gunakan kekunci belakang untuk keluar dari desktop anda.

Sekarang, palamkan telefon anda, seolah-olah anda akan memindahkan lagu atau gambar. Tetapi kali ini jangan tarik tempat teduh dan pasang kad SD. Anda akan mendapat mesej "Found New Hardware" dari Windows.

Pilih "Cari dan pasang perisian pemacu."

Pilih "Jangan cari dalam talian."

Pilih "Saya tidak mempunyai cakera. Tunjuk saya pilihan lain."

Pilih "Semak imbas komputer saya untuk perisian pemacu."

Sekarang semak imbas ke folder SDK, dan tunjuk Windows ke folder bernama usb_driver. Klik imej di bawah untuk membesarkannya dan lihat folder usb_driver di dalam SDK Android anda.

Tinggalkan "Sertakan subfolder" ditandakan, dan klik "Seterusnya." Windows mungkin bertanya kepada anda jika anda pasti. Katakanlah ya jika ia berlaku. Apabila tingkap melakukan perkara itu, dan meminta anda jika anda mahu memasang "Pemacu antara muka Google ADB" katakan ya.

Sudah tentu jika kita mahu menjalankan emulator atau aplikasi program ada lebih banyak lagi. Tetapi untuk tujuan kami, kami sudah selesai. Cabutkan plag telefon anda dan but semula komputer anda.

Sekarang adalah masa yang baik untuk menyebut bahawa anda mungkin tidak perlu reboot PC anda semasa telefon anda dipasang. Sesetengah PC baru boleh boot dari peranti USB, dan akan cuba memuatkan Android ke PC anda jika anda melakukannya. Seperti yang menarik kerana bunyi itu, ia tidak akan berfungsi, dan boleh membawa kepada masalah.

Lucu bagaimana bahagian paling sukar bagi keseluruhan operasi itu ialah memasang Windows bukan?

Ujian pertama: Sandarkan apl anda

Inilah trik yang boleh dilakukan oleh sesiapa sahaja, walaupun dengan telefon tidak diganggu. Palamkan telefon anda ke komputer, sama seperti yang anda lakukan jika anda memindahkan gambar atau lagu, kecuali sekali lagi jangan tarik bawah naungan dan pasang kad SD. Pada bila-bila masa kita berinteraksi dengan telefon melalui arahan arahan, kad tersebut perlu terus dicabut.

Sekarang buka command prompt anda. Di Windows, cukup tekan menu permulaan dan ketik (sama ada dalam medan carian Windows 7 atau perintah "lari" dalam XP) "cmd." Jangan biarkan komputer 1960-an kelihatan menakutkan anda, ini akan mudah.

Pada prompt, navigasi ke lokasi yang anda masukkan SDK Android. Jika anda mengikuti contoh kami, taipkan (atau salin dan tampal) perkara berikut dalam baris arahan anda:

cd C: \ Android_stuff \ android-sdk-windows

Jika anda menggunakan lokasi yang berbeza, ubah suai arahan untuk menunjuk ke lokasi yang telah anda buat SDK Android anda.

Di dalam SDK terdapat beberapa folder lain. Yang kita biasanya akan bekerjasama ialah folder alat. Navigasi ke dalamnya dengan menaip yang berikut ke dalam arahan arahan anda:

alat cd

Klik gambar di bawah untuk mendapatkan pandangan yang lebih besar mengenai arahan-arahan yang diketik ke dalam arahan arahan Windows.

Sekarang buka pengurus fail anda, dan di ruang kerja anda buat folder yang dipanggil aplikasi. Kami akan menyokong semua aplikasi kami di sini. Pasaran menyimpan rekod tentang apa yang telah anda bayar, tetapi kadang-kadang mencari yang percuma sekali lagi boleh menjadi kesakitan, jadi biarkan menyimpan salinan kami sendiri. Jika anda menatal halaman ke imej folder Android_stuff saya, anda akan melihat subfolder apl sudah ada di sana.

Pada jenis prompt anda berikut:

adb pull / data / app / C: \ Android_stuff \ apps

Hanya salin dan tampalkannya. Apa maksudnya ialah -

  • gunakan program adb (disediakan oleh Google sebagai sebahagian daripada Android SDK) untuk menarik fail.
  • Fail yang kami tarik dari telefon terletak di / data / aplikasi pada telefon itu sendiri.
  • Apabila fail ditarik balik, kami ingin menampalnya ke C: \ Android_stuff \ apps.

Kenapa garis miring berbeza dari bahagian pertama arahan ke bahagian kedua?

Ini kerana kita berurusan dengan dua sistem fail berbeza. Dalam sistem fail Windows, slash adalah ke belakang, seperti " \ ". Sistem fail Unix menggunakan slaid ke hadapan " / " untuk memisahkan folder. / data / apl / berada di telefon, dan menggunakan sistem fail Unix. C: \ Android_stuff \ apps adalah pada PC anda supaya ia menggunakan sistem fail Windows.

Anda mungkin melihat mesej tentang pelayan yang sedang lapuk, atau pelayan yang terbunuh. Ini merujuk kepada pelayan adb, dan perintah itu akan menyegarkannya jika perlu. Jangan bimbang, ia automatik. Anda akan melihat tingkap mula tatal, dengan output dari adb memberitahu anda ia disalin setiap aplikasi. Tidak ada interaksi yang diperlukan, biarkan ia tatal. Apabila selesai, anda akan kembali pada arahan arahan anda. Kini satu salinan semua aplikasi pasaran percuma anda disimpan di PC anda untuk penyimpanan selamat. Fail semua mempunyai pelanjutan ".apk". Ini adalah format pemasangan Android standard, jadi fail ini tidak boleh digunakan dalam Windows.

Tiada akar. Tiada perintah shell yang berbelit-belit. Hanya cara mudah untuk menyandarkan semua aplikasi anda. Aplikasi ini boleh disalin ke kad SD anda, dan dipasang dengan mana-mana aplikasi yang boleh membaca kad dan memasang fail apk. Jika anda tidak mempunyai aplikasi untuk ini, cari Astro di pasaran. Ia berfungsi sebagai file explorer (seperti My Computer in Windows) dan menawarkan beberapa alat hebat yang lain untuk pengurusan aplikasi.

Ini hanyalah hujung iceburg. Sehingga Android keluar dengan aplikasi gaya iTunes yang mudah digunakan untuk berinteraksi dengan peranti itu, saya di sini untuk membantu anda bekerja dengan baris arahan. Setiap minggu kami akan memberi tumpuan kepada sesuatu yang serupa. Selamat meretas:)

Pilihan Minggu

Overclocking Droid anda (root diperlukan!)

Peranti Android yang paling popular kini mempunyai peningkatan ciri yang paling diminta. Kernel telah ditapis dan pemproses telah overclocked. Berikut adalah topik pembangunnya, dan pengguna A / C thebizz telah memulakan perbincangan di forum kami sendiri.

AMARAN: Potensi di sini dapat merosakkan peranti anda (seperti semua pengubahsuaian), tetapi pemaju telah melakukan pekerjaan yang baik menjadikannya lebih mudah. Beliau juga telah menubuhkan kawasan sokongan khusus untuk soalan. Ini pendapat peribadi saya bahawa pemproses Droid boleh mengambil sedikit lebih banyak penyalahgunaan daripada Moto yang ditetapkan, jadi ini boleh menjadi pembaruan yang sangat berguna. Sekiranya anda mencuba ini, pastikan anda berkongsi pengalaman anda dalam forum ini, kerana ramai orang kelihatan berada di pagar dengan yang satu ini. Sudah tentu anda perlu berakar dan mempunyai imej pemulihan tersuai. Jika ini semua Greek kepada anda. Anda akan mendapat banyak bantuan dalam forum ini.

Nexus One ROM Cyanogen (root diperlukan!)

Legenda Android Hacker / Cooker / Modder / Guru Cyanogen telah mengeluarkan ROM tersuai untuk anda pemilik Nexus One beruntung. Sebahagian daripada hacks G1nya tidak disertakan, kerana tidak ada keperluan dengan perkakasan hebat Nexus One. Tetapi itu bukan untuk mengatakan ini tidak penuh dengan barangan. Berikut adalah beberapa sorotan:

  • Terbaru 2.6.29.6 kernel, yang menyokong tethering, vpn, dan modul lain (cifs, nfs, aufs, fius)
  • Dibina dalam tether USB
  • FLAC sokongan audio
  • Termasuk BusyBox, htop, nano, powertop, openvpn, dan semua utiliti commandline kejuruteraan

Sudah tentu ada lagi, itu hanya senarai pendek. Kerja Cyanogen selalu menjadi perhatian, cukup sehingga banyak perubahannya telah dimasukkan ke dalam pokok sumber Android. Ia satu perintah yang tinggi untuk membuat Nexus One berfungsi lebih baik daripada yang sudah dilakukan, tetapi saya boleh memberitahu anda ini - ia melakukan segala-galanya tetapi terbang menggunakan binaan ini, dan saya sangat mengesyorkan anda melihatnya.

Laman web Cyanogen Mod http://www.cyanogenmod.com/. A / C pengguna rsvpinx telah memulakan topik perbincangan A / C mengenai ROM di sini dalam forum kami.

MetaMorph (root diperlukan!)

Mungkin MetaMorph adalah aplikasi. Mungkin ia akan lebih baik disambut dengan semakan penuh dalam forum Permohonan. Tetapi saya tidak boleh mendapatkan cukup alat ini. Apa yang dilakukannya adalah membolehkan pengguna akhir memuat turun tema tersuai dan memuatkannya di telefon tanpa masalah pemulihan imej dan ROM berkelip. Saya bercakap dengan Stericson di pemaju XDA dan bertanya kepadanya beberapa soalan mengenai permohonan itu:

Aplikasi anda adalah terobosan besar dalam cara tema dan elemen visual diubah oleh pengguna akhir. Bagaimana anda memikirkannya?

Apakah sumber yang anda cadangkan seseorang yang baru kepada Android dan aplikasi anda melihat untuk menjadikannya lebih mudah untuk menggunakan MetaMorph?

Anda memberikan pengguna anda kemas kini tepat pada masanya. Bolehkah anda memberi kami sebarang berita tentang ciri-ciri yang akan datang?

Keputusan untuk menyediakan ciri yang sama yang ditetapkan dalam versi percuma dan menderma sangat baik untuk pengguna. Adakah anda rasa ia melumpuhkan apa-apa potensi untuk keuntungan sebenar?

Di manakah pemaju tema pemula akan mula membuat tema MetaMorph?

Saya ingin mengucapkan terima kasih kepada Stericson kerana meluangkan masa untuk menjawab beberapa soalan untuk kami, dan untuk aplikasi yang hebat. Menggunakan MetaMorph, sesiapa yang mempunyai bakat untuk kerja-kerja grafik dengan mudah boleh menjadi pemaju tema Android.

Seperti yang dinyatakan oleh Stericson, benang sokongan rasmi untuk aplikasi bersama-sama dengan satu ton maklumat adalah di pemaju XDA di sini. Pengguna A / C mclarryjr telah memulakan perbincangan yang bagus di forum kami tentang cara membuat sihir dengan yang ini di forum kami. Tekan QRcode dari telefon anda (atau klik pada penyemak imbas Android anda) untuk pergi terus ke pasaran dan ambil MetaMorph.

Semoga anda menikmati ansuran dalam Inside Android minggu ini. Ingat saya sentiasa mencari petua dan pendapat Cari saya di forum atau drop me a line [email protected]